Installation of Parental Control Software
  1. Click to activate....
    Log in to Customer Self Care.
    Select the [Activate] button to continue with installing the Parental Control Software .

  2. Note your username and password.
    This username and password are the Master User and Password for the Parental Control Software. This is used for installing, configuring, and removing the software.
    Select the link to download the software.

  3. Download and install the software
    The installation of the Parental Control Software requires a number of steps.
    • Do you want to run or save this file?
      Select [Run]
    • On some systems there will be a security warning. If this happens select [Run]
    • On the Welcome screen select [Next >]
    • Read the License Agreement and then click [I Agree]
    • On the Choose Install Location screen click [Install]
    • Next will appear a blue Welcome screen. Click the [Next >] button
    • Master Account Password
      Here you will put in the Master Account Username and Password as you were assigned by the system in step 2. Once you have filled in the form, click on the [Next >] button.
    HINT
    It may be easiest for most families to create a single children's profile and if unrestricted access is required they can simply Snooze all filtering to allow full access to the Internet. See below for more information on Snooze all filtering

    • Add a Profile
      You may have many profiles, one for each user of the computer for example. Each profile can allow access to various items on the Internet. This first profile is set up during installation and you can add more profiles later. Select a profile name (for example "kids") and password and enter these. Then select one of the preset levels for access such as child or teenager. You will be able to adjust the settings later.
      Once you have entered this profile information select [Next >]
    • The finish screen will appear, click the [Finish] button
    • The completing installation screen will reappear. You must reboot to complete the installation of the software select [Finish] now and your computer will be automatically restarted.
    That brings you to the end of the installation of the software.

    NOTICE
    wfilter.exe must be allowed to access the Internet by any firewall or security software in order for Bruce Telecom Parental Controls Software to work.

Working with Profiles in Parental Control Software WARNING
The last profile used is the active profile. If you are using an adult profile and want to leave the computer you will want to change the profile to a children's profile first.
  1. Creating Additional Profiles
    You can run the Parental Control Software with a single profile and if unrestricted access is required there is a Snooze feature available to disable Parental Control Software for a period (for example 15 minutes). Otherwise you may wish to add additional profiles.
    • Click Add New Profile
    • Enter the Master Password
    • Choose a profile name, password and preset. "Kid Safe" only allows a list of webpages that you define to be viewed. See Customize current profile for more details.
      Do not use the Master Password for this password
    This will add a new profile

  2. Switching between profiles
    • Select Switch current profile
    • Select the profile name you wish to switch to
    • Enter the password associated with that profile
    This will switch to the selected profile

  3. Customize current profile
    • Select Customize current profile
    • Enter the Master Password
    • You can change the profile name or profile password or just click [Next >]
    • Adjust the web browsing settings and click [Next >]
    • Adjust File Sharing, Instant Messaging, and Newsgroup settings and click [Next >]
    • Add websites to the Always Allow or Always Block lists. If the profile is a "Kid Safe" profile then only sites listed in the Always Allow list will be available. This is the ultimate security for small children as you must add each site that you approve. Once done click [Next >].
    • Click [Finish >].


  1. Snooze all filtering
    • Select Snooze all filtering
    • Select the amount of time you wish the filtering to be snoozed.
    • Enter the Master Password to enable the Snooze.

  2. Web Alerts
    Web Alerts allow you to have a site blocked instantly and an alert sent to be manually checked for categorization. You would do this if a site comes up that may not be properly categorized or uncategorized and it should be.


    Uninstalling Parental Control Software
  1. Removing the Parental Control Software
    • In the Control Panel select Add or Remove Programs
    • Select Parental Control Software from the list and click Remove
    • In the Welcome screen click [Next >]
    • Select [Uninstall >]
    • Enter the Master Password and click [OK]
    • Reboot the computer when requested
